Job Description
The Nova Scotia Placement Pass Nurse (LPN) will practice in accordance with legislation and the standards as determined by their regulatory body and the practice setting. The Placement Pass nurse will have the knowledge to assess, select, implement, and evaluate a wide range of nursing interventions to ensure consistent safe, competent, and ethical care. Placement Pass Program nurses provide a review and determination as to whether a student has met the criteria for placement based on pre-established standards and protocols of the student’s clinical program.
